SUSTAINABILITY INNOVATION
Republic’s recent innovations to advance circularity and decarbonization demonstrate our unique ability to leverage sustainability as a platform for growth.
The Republic Services Polymer Center is the nation’s first integrated plastics recycling facility. This innovative site processes rigid plastics from our recycling centers, producing recycled materials that promote true bottle-to-bottle circularity. We also formed Blue Polymers, a joint venture with Ravago, to develop facilities that will further process plastic material from our Polymer Centers to help meet the growing demand for sustainable packaging. We are building a network of Polymer Centers and Blue Polymer facilities across North America.
We continue to advance decarbonization at our landfills. As demand for renewable energy continues to grow, we have 70 landfill gas-to-energy projects in operation and plan to expand our portfolio to 115 projects by 2028.

Which visa types are most common for solution manager roles in Nevada?
The H-1B is the most common visa for solution manager positions in Nevada, as the role typically requires a bachelor's degree in a relevant field such as computer science, information systems, or business administration. Candidates from Australia may qualify for the E-3 visa, while Canadian and Mexican nationals often use the TN visa under the USMCA. L-1 transfers are also used when a candidate moves from an overseas office of the same employer.

Are there any Nevada-specific considerations for solution manager visa sponsorship?
Nevada has no state income tax, which affects how employers structure compensation packages and can influence prevailing wage calculations under the H-1B program. The state's economy is heavily tied to hospitality, gaming technology, and data infrastructure, so solution manager candidates with domain expertise in those industries tend to be more competitive. Nevada's lack of major research universities with technology programs means fewer local graduate pipelines, which can increase employer openness to international hiring.
What is the prevailing wage for sponsored solution manager jobs in Nevada?
U.S. employers sponsoring a visa must pay at least the prevailing wage, which is what workers in the same role, area, and experience level typically earn. The Department of Labor sets this rate to make sure companies aren't hiring foreign workers simply because they'd accept lower pay than a U.S. worker. It varies by job title, location, and experience. You can look up current prevailing wage rates for any occupation and location using the OFLC Wage Search page.
